Transaction de6511d26036c9f51ad45dcb67a28133cabed5e114d29ad62830a1f6439fa4db
1 Input
1 Output
-
de6511d26036c9f51ad45dcb67a28133cabed5e114d29ad62830a1f6439fa4db:0
- value
- 2906646
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46fa3a7bfd0f7844421b9d0221792f897beb941f OP_EQUAL
- address
- 38AJz9dqAENvn5C5xSchEtDhjyQNPEMKvU